A Georgia man dressed in a Nazi officer’s uniform was arrested Friday after he allegedly smashed a glass beer pitcher in the face of a female University of Georgia student and broke her nose outside of a bar.
The incident was captured in a video and took place later Thursday night in Athens, Ga., after Kenneth Leland Morgan, 32, allegedly tried to enter Cutters Pub while wearing a Nazi uniform. He was confronted by a group of people outside the bar who prevented him from entering.
“Get the f–k out, get the f–k out, you don’t f–king wear that s–t,” a woman yells at Morgan as she appears to push him away so he can’t enter the bar, according to footage from a video taken at the scene.
